XML 108 R75.htm IDEA: XBRL DOCUMENT v3.25.0.1
INCOME TAXES - Reconciliation of Unrecognized Tax Benefits (Details) - USD ($)
$ in Thousands
12 Months Ended
Dec. 31, 2024
Dec. 31, 2023
Reconciliation of Unrecognized Tax Benefits [Roll Forward]    
Gross unrecognized tax benefit, beginning of period $ 1,257 $ 702
Additions based on tax positions related to the current year 410 555
Additions based on tax positions related to the prior years 0 0
Reductions due to lapse in statute of limitations and settlements (255) 0
Gross unrecognized tax benefit, end of period $ 1,412 $ 1,257